AFC Leopards staged a spirited comeback to defeat Shabana 2–1 in a dramatic FKF Premier League encounter at the Gusii Stadium on Wednesday afternoon.

The hosts got off to a flying start when young forward Austine Odongo found the back of the net early in the first half, sending the home crowd into celebration.

But Leopards refused to fold, with coach Fred Ambani’s halftime substitutions changing the course of the match.

Captain Victor Omune drew Ingwe level midway through the second half after a brilliant assist from substitute Julius Masaba.

The visitors sealed the comeback late on when James Kinyanjui’s curling corner kick caused confusion in the Shabana box, leading to an own goal that silenced the home fans.

The victory — Leopards’ second consecutive win and fifth match unbeaten — propels them to fifth on the log with nine points, just four behind league leaders Kakamega Homeboyz.

For Shabana, it was another tough day at home — their third straight loss and fourth game without a win, piling pressure on coach Peter Okidi to find solutions before their next outing.

Meanwhile, in Kericho, Kakamega Homeboyz continued their impressive form with a 2–1 win over APS Bomet, opening up a three-point lead at the top of the standings.
